About the Airtac B06-SU Battery Dedicated Standard Cylinder B06-SU63X50S

The AirTAC B06-SU63X50S is a discontinued double-acting profile cylinder. The B06- prefix marks it as a battery-manufacturing dedicated variant of the SU63X50S, mechanically identical to the base model. Delivering 1559 N push at 0.5 MPa through a 63 mm bore, it is replaced drop-in by the SAU63X50S. This upgrade keeps the 3/8" port, M16x1.5 rod thread, 50 mm stroke, and SC-series mounting identical.

The extruded aluminum profile is shorter than an ISO 15552 cylinder of the same bore. For sizing, a safe working load is roughly 935 N (60% of the 0.5 MPa push), or a 79 kg vertical lift with a 2:1 margin. Note that the -S magnet on this legacy SU worked with CS1-B/DS1-B switches, whereas the SAU replacement uses current CMSG/DMSG/EMSG sensors. The SAU line also adds a SAUF valve-integrated option the SU lacked.

Replacing the Airtac B06-SU Battery Dedicated Standard Cylinder B06-SU63X50S with the B06-SAU63X50S

To replace this B06-SU63X50S, order the SAU63X50S. It is a true drop-in: matching the 63 mm bore, 50 mm stroke, 3/8" port, and SC-series mounts. If your battery line used the -S magnet for position sensing, you must upgrade to CMSG/DMSG/EMSG switches, as the old CS1-B/DS1-B sensors are obsolete. If you need faster cycling, the SAUF variant integrates a 4M solenoid valve directly on the body. For sizing alternatives, dropping to a 50 mm bore yields 982 N push at 0.5 MPa, while an 80 mm bore provides 2513 N. Remember, a plain cylinder drifts without live air; use an external rod lock for vertical load holding.
